   comparison of aged and fresh automotive three-way catalyst in driving cycle

چکیده    Recently, environmental concern and demand for a catalyst’s high performance have increased and many research activities focused on the operation of a three-way catalyst (twc) at the end of its lifetime. catalyst aging is the loss of catalytic activity over time that has crucial importance in the emission of the three-way catalyst. the aim of this paper is, investigating experimentally the performance of a fresh and aged three-way catalytic converter (twc) in the legislative driving cycle. for this, vehicle emission test with fresh and aged catalyst was carried out. in this study, a commercial catalyst was used and was aged in a motor-rig, with sbc cycle (standard bench cycle). the total conversions of hc, co and nox were decreased over the lean-rich cycles in transient conditions. in the real driving condition, almost in the all-time, the engine has a transient condition and in this condition, the non-aged catalyst achieves higher conversion for times with lambda variations.
